Maintaining International Adherence via Rigorous ISO and Safety Standards

In the world of battery manufacturing, adherence with global protocols is the bedrock of safety and reliability. The production processes are strictly governed by ISO-9001 certification, which indicates a strong commitment to quality management systems that are recognized worldwide. This standard ensures that every step of our manufacturing process, from material material procurement to end assembly, is documented, monitored, and continuously refined. It reduces inconsistency in manufacturing, meaning that the initial unit from the assembly is just as dependable as the thousandth. For businesses looking for a high-performance Lithium Battery Pack, this degree of verified excellence offers peace of mind that the product will function securely and consistently, regardless of the scale of the order.

In addition to process control, safety during transportation and operation is verified through UN38.3 certification. This essential standard involves subjecting batteries to severe trials, comprising altitude simulation, thermal cycling, vibration, shock, and outside short circuit assessments. Only units that survive these strenuous evaluations are considered secure for international shipping and integration. Conformity to these rules is mandatory for any company that plans to ship goods over boundaries or utilize air cargo, since it certifies that the power storage device is stable under stress situations.
